The Study Of The Relationship Between The Levels Of Fibrinogen And Carotid Atherosclerosis In Patients With Ischemic Stroke

Objective To analyze carotid atheromatous plaque in patients ischemic stroke and explore the relationship between carotid atheromatous plaque and fibrinogen.Methods In sixty nine cases with ischemic stroke,the location,number, nature of carotid atheromatous plaque and diamete of carotid artery and Intima-media thickness of bifurcation of common carotid artery were assessed by Doppler ultrasonography,and other related indexes such as blood pressure,NIHSS score,fibrinogen and D Dimer were evaluate.Results The atheromatous plaques were detected in bifurcation of common carotid artery(52.29%),common carotid artery(42.20%)and extracranial part of internal carotid artery(5.51%).the number of carotid atheromatous plaque was 1.65±0.99.The level of fibrinogen in arterial sclerosis group(≥0.9mm)was obviously higher than normal vessel group(<0.9mm)(P<0.05).The numbers of carotid atheromatous plaque and intima-media thickness in normal,high fibrinogen group were obviously higher than low fibrinogen(P<0.01),and D Dimer between two groups also has significant difference(P<0.01).Conclusion There was deeply relationship between carotid atherosclerosis and ischemic stroke,and the level of fibrinogen was the important,dependent risk factor for carotid atherosclerosis and ischemic stroke.carotid atherosclerosis was directly related with the deficit of neuro function in patients with cerebral infarction.
